    Approach: 

    I like to think of this as a different kind of coaching that is built around how your brain actually works

    My approach is rooted in the belief that neurodivergent people don’t need to try harder.  Instead, they need strategies that are designed for them. Using my background in lifestyle medicine, health coaching and motivational interviewing, I work with clients to understand the unique way their brain operates, then builds practical, personalised frameworks around exactly that….. and not around ‘what works for everyone else’.

    The sessions are collaborative, non-judgmental and grounded in both clinical evidence and lived experience. I integrates the latest thinking in neurodiversity, lifestyle medicine and behaviour change to help you make sustainable progress across executive function, health habits, body confidence, career transitions and beyond.

    There are no generic programmes. No one-size-fits-all advice. Just a thoughtful, structured partnership which is focused on what actually works for you.

    Specialisation: 

    My area of specialism is in ADHD and Autism, as well as helping adults with things such as body dysmorphia and eating disorders. 

    Having been diagnosed myself with ADHD and autism, and real life lived experiences of body dysmorphia and binge eating disorders, I can now coach from a place of genuine understanding – not just clinical knowledge. 

    I bring genuine personal insight into what it means to navigate the world as a neurodivergent person.
